Output f24f66dd4fe38a4f5493679849c4ffa8539a33c580a07bd1113fbfa7638901be:1

value
45822510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e27efad3f8c410b01a4823d84156107ab4d6d661 OP_EQUALVERIFY OP_CHECKSIG
address
1Mebq4kSgrFfDXf7UrkCgAQAJKsaZPQdcq
transaction
f24f66dd4fe38a4f5493679849c4ffa8539a33c580a07bd1113fbfa7638901be
spent
true